Preschool teachers do not miss the opportunity to receive support money from the 26 trillion social security package
(Baonghean.vn) - Recently, there have been many opinions that the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s "refused" to accept support applications for non-public preschool teachers at 5 non-public preschools. However, the nature of the matter is completely different.
Accordingly, immediately after receiving the list of 37 people from 5 non-public preschools in Vinh City, the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s took many actions to speed up the completion of payment records for non-public preschool teachers.
Responding to the reception of dossiers from non-public preschools, the representative of the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s said that the city had received 5 dossiers from 5 school units, including a list of 37 teachers approved by the city. However, through the appraisal process, it was found that although the subjects met the standards of the subject group specified in Article 13, Article 14, Chapter IV, Decision 23/QD-TTg, there were still some details that did not meet the system of documents of the Ministry of Education & Training and the standards of Article 13, Article 14, Chapter IV, Decision 23, so the Department requested the city to review.
"In the official dispatch requesting Vinh city to review, we also asked the city to follow state documents to ensure that no subjects are left out," said Mr. Doan Hong Vu - Director of the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s.

Accordingly, upon receiving 5 sets of documents from non-public preschools including 37 teachers and workers proposed for support under Resolution 68/NQ-CP and Decision 23/2021/QD-TTg, the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s issued Official Dispatch No. 2674/SLĐTB & XH - VL dated August 11, 2021 to the Department of Education and Training, regarding coordination in implementing support for workers as prescribed in Article 13, Article 14, Chapter IV of Decision No. 23/2021/QD-TTg dated July 7, 2021 of the Prime Minister in Nghe An province.
In this dispatch, the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s stated: Based on the provisions of Decision 23 and other relevant regulations, the Department of Education and Training is requested to propose support for employees working at private educational institutions that must stop operations at the request of competent state agencies to prevent the epidemic, from which the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s has a basis to report and propose to the Provincial People's Committee to consider and guide the implementation of support policies for employees in the above group of subjects.
This document also requests the Department of Education and Training to clearly define the summer vacation time for the 2020-2021 school year for private educational institutions.
If the summer vacation coincides with the epidemic break but teachers are still entitled to receive salary according to Article 3 of Circular 48 of the Ministry of Education and Training, then according to the provisions of Article 13, Article 14, Chapter IV, Decision 23, employees are not entitled to receive benefits in this list.
After receiving the official dispatch from the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s, on August 13, 2021, the Department of Education and Training also issued Official Dispatch 1597/SGD & DT-TCCB on coordinating the implementation of support for workers according to Decision No. 23/QD-TTg dated 07/07/2021 of the Prime Minister.
According to this document, the Department of Education and Training stated: Particularly for preschools that are organized to operate during the summer when parents need to send their children, on the principle of voluntary participation in the agreement. However, due to the epidemic situation, all non-public preschools are required to stop operating until July 26, 2021, the Department has just issued Document No. 1459/SGD & DT-VP allowing them to resume operations from July 28, 2021.
The Department of Education and Training also requested the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s to send an official dispatch to the Provincial People's Committee to consider implementing support policies for workers.
Regarding this, the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s stated its opinion: We only hope that the parties review according to current regulations so that preschool teachers can receive support according to regulations. Therefore, upon receiving the official dispatch from the Department of Education and Training, we request the city to review according to the spirit of Decision 23, to have specific advice for the Provincial People's Committee.
“Assuming that teachers are not entitled to the benefits according to the regulations in accordance with the epidemic break time coinciding with the summer break according to Article 3 of Circular 48 of the Ministry of Education and Training, they will still receive the support package in August and September. Therefore, regardless of the situation, non-public preschool teachers will still receive support of more than 3.7 million VND according to the regulations in Article 13, Article 14, Chapter IV of Decision 23/QD-TTg dated 07/2021 of the Prime Minister on support for workers affected by the Covid-19 epidemic” - Director of the Department of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s Doan Hong Vu said.
Nghe An province has 58 non-public kindergartens, 290 independent nursery groups, 113 managers, 2,240 teachers, and 686 employees.
